Output 57d89dd19da56936139ee8f3b10d2c4e2c4154707275293c554f3fb962ecb016:3

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 504691518c67125939cbd693d59903ba3136669e OP_EQUALVERIFY OP_CHECKSIG
address
18KTbURLswgQm7dwMNiyo2KaaAFN5yPAXk
transaction
57d89dd19da56936139ee8f3b10d2c4e2c4154707275293c554f3fb962ecb016
spent
true